We have just started generating mp-rage volume scans from our new 3T Siemens
Trio, using the 8-channel head coil.
The images look great, with excellent grey-white matter contrast, but there
is a noticeable bias field.
Fast seems to make a great job of bias-correcting these images, but I have
two questions:
1) I wonder whether it is possible (on the command line) to simply
bias-correct the images, without doing the segmentation? Or does the
segmentation not really contribute to the processing time?
2) Is it possible to apply the generated bias field image to another image
(i.e. The non-skullstripped image)? Is it simply a matter of multiplying in
avwmaths?
